About The Artwork

These pair come as 2 parts 87 x 110cm | 34 x 43in 86 x 94cm | 34 x 37in Double glazed resembles for me the idea of multiple windows, multiple perspectives, multiple ways to see. The use of double is the idea of 2 which is about polarities. How things work in these polarities and opposite forces. But when you look there are 3 layers of windows divided into 2 parts. For me this is the idea that there is more beyond what we perceive, there is more beyond the idea of polarities and opposing forces. There’s more beyond just the positive and negative. There is a space of unity, neutrality that also exists outside of this. Sometimes we can get lost in the polarities of life but it is important to remember that there is more beyond this way of seeing. Many more ways to see and perceive life. Once we see beyond polarity, into unity we can then begin to see all the windows and different facets of life.

Janine Saul (b. 1997, London) is a conceptual textile artist. Janine's intrigue in the art of screen-printing stemmed from an interest in the possibilities of creating dimension and texture on fabric surfaces. By challenging the traditionally linear formula of the screen-printing process through manipulating screens, creating resists, and developing dye formulas, Janine has cultivated an experimental practice that implements her discoveries to create form-focused, layered outcomes rooted in depth and emotion. While playing with textural quality by pushing the boundaries of print, Janine's work is heavily informed by her lifestyle as a world traveller, gathering inspiration and teachings from around the world to create intricate pieces that aim to understand the many layers and constructions of the human experience, using colour and dimension to embody a space, time, moment and feeling. Describing her approach to creation as a desire to 'bring the invisible to the visible', Janine's work aims to reveal what happens in the spaces beyond the perceived eye. Through spatial installations, Janine employs movement to expose, conceal and reveal spaces to ourselves. Through her travels, Janine has positioned her work in diverse locations from the remote jungle of Mexico to conventional gallery spaces and has exhibited globally across London, New York, Mexico, Peru, France, Italy, and Greece.
